In the US, at least, its common to simply pay that $1k phone over time on a plan - or simply never stop paying off a phone through an upgrade program, either through their carrier or direct (e.g. iPhone Upgrade Program). $30/mo doesn't hit as hard as $1100 up front. For some consumers, its a fundamentally different way of thinking. |
